WebJun 11, 2024 · The Eucharistic martyrs of Casamari. On May 13, 1799, the day after Pentecost, as their army retreated north through Italy, a small detachment of twenty French soldiers broke off from the main force and entered the Cistercian monastery of Casamari, where they were welcomed by the prior, Fr. Siméon Cardon, and given food and drink. WebJun 25, 2024 · Updated on June 25, 2024. The Eucharist is another name for Holy Communion or the Lord's Supper. WebJul 20, 1998 · The Eucharist (from the Greek eucharistia for “thanksgiving”) is the central act of Christian worship and is practiced by most Christian churches in some form. WebThe sacrament of Christ's body and blood, and the principal act of Christian worship. The term is from the Greek, “thanksgiving.”. Jesus instituted the eucharist “on the night when he was betrayed.”. At the Last Supper he shared the bread and cup of wine at a sacred meal with his disciples.
